DTE Community Nite Lite set for October 26, 2013

This is the night! We, once again, are challenging the community to break a record for the most lit jack-o-lanterns in one place. We are asking everyone to carve your pumpkins and then bring them over to the Cultural Center on Saturday, October 26 beginning at 3 p.m. The Cultural Center grounds will be ablaze with over 1,000 pumpkins for the DTE COMMUNITY NITE LITE beginning at 6 p.m. The official pumpkin count will be announced at 7 p.m. Come on out and see this spectacular sight, enjoy refreshments and even purchase a carved pumpkin! DTE will donate $1 per carved pumpkin and all proceeds go to First Step Women and Children’s Domestic Violence Center.
